Working in the Trenches....
(Monday February 04, 2008) Written by BStephens989
A lot of times people, aka other jocks, will look at me like..."dude, you're in market 2 hundred whatever". Well, here's the thing about market "two hundred whatever"...it's more work than you could ever imagine AND the sky's the limit with possibilities. I may be a small market jock, but that doesn't mean I think of myself as a small market jock. I have more remotes than I can imagine, I get to go to all the best concerts AND I have a great show! Sure large market stations pay big bucks for their remotes, but really...how many remotes do you hear from Large Market Jocks? Not near as many as small markets. See small markets know that if you want to win, you have to win in the streets AND in the halls! We may have minimal promotional budgets and no we don't have a Custom Motorcoach with our logo plastered on it for that ONE festival appearance a year, but we do have relatability with our local content, we have compassion for radio and life in general and we may care about numbers...ratings...marketsize...payroll...but they don't define who we are. The only downside to being a small market jock? It can be overwhelming. It can be downright exhausting. But at the end of the day when you are staring at a stage with one of your hottest artists and looking at the hordes of your listeners having the time of their life and it's all on a minimal budget...it all seems worth it. No matter what size your market is...there will always be pro's and con's...the question is whether or not you are the Dedicated, Passionate Pro.

Be The Star Player.
(Tuesday November 20, 2007) Written by bmac
There is a radio station based in the city I live in that isn’t a great ratings performer. Each book that comes out they have either held their lowly position or gone down slightly. It’s a little sad to see because it is a station with great potential. They just seem happy to plod along and maintain their current status. I have been listening to them on and off for the past week trying to figure out what it is that isn’t working for them. The list is long. The music is wrong, the focus is wrong and their overall image is disconnected. However, that’s not what interests me. I pay special attention to the presenters. Even with a poorly focussed product, a good presenter can pull decent ratings out of the fire. But in order to do this, they need goals. They need direction. It’s obvious, listening to this station, that they get none of these. Today I listened for one-hour non-stop. I ended up shouting at my radio (I can get a bit passionate about bad/good presentation)! ‘Stop talking’, I cried. ‘For the love of God, quit talking now’!! I’ll give you an example of what I was listening to and why I got a little carried away. Let’s say the station is an Oldies format. Just for argument’s sake. And let’s say I was listening to the afternoon drive presenter. The first thing that drove me crazy was the amount of crutches he used. “A very good afternoon to you” “Hope all is well in your world” “How is your Friday afternoon going for you” “The weather is awful out there today”, that sort of thing. Next was the biggest crutch of all: the time check. It was great to know that it was “5:15” and then”5:21” and then”5:25” and let’s not forget “5:31”. I would never have thought to look at my watch if I needed to know the exact time (every five minutes)! Then there was the needless back sell. An example being, “That was Elvis Presley there”, (no kidding). This was followed by more needless back selling that told us nothing, moved the station no where and sounded like the presenter was speaking just for the sake of it (which he was). The biggest crime I heard, however, was two fold. In this one particular link, the presenter proceeded to do a piece about Lindsay Lohan, the actress. This could be a fine piece of showbiz fluff. However, let’s remember the format here. We’re talking Oldies. We’re concentrating on an audience that enjoys that style of music and the people that went along with it. Is Lindsay Lohan someone that an Oldies audience will relate to? In my opinion, no. To me, it’s like working on a Country format and doing a major piece of 50 Cent, What is the point? Well, you say, she’s a big star. That’s true. Sometimes big stars are worth the mention. That could come down to you making a programming decision on that one yourself. I only give my opinion on that. However, the Lindsay Lohan piece lasted a full two minutes and twenty three seconds, (yes, I did time it. Pathetic, I know)! That’s a lot of time on one idea. On a music station. The killer for me, though, was the fact that the presenter was reading it. Out of a magazine. A magazine that I had read last week. I remember the article. I remember sitting down and reading the very same article. Word for word. He was reading something to me that I had read for myself one week ago. Why did he do this? He did this because no more is expected of him. The station’s standards are low. Their expectations are low. Their level of commitment is low. Their basic requirements are low. Their feed back to the presenters is low. They really sound as if they don’t care. Why should he put any extra effort into his link if he doesn’t feel the need? The PD won’t say anything. The GM won’t notice. Why bother? The very fact that it ‘sounds’ as though he his presenting is enough for him. By reading an article, he is giving the listener nothing. If you are going to present a piece on Lindsay Lohan, wouldn’t it be better to put it into your own words? Put your own unique spin on it? Make it your own? The journalist that wrote the piece did just that. Why would a radio person be lazy and think that that was good enough. Well, possibly for that very reason: it’s just ‘good enough’. Not ‘good’, just ‘good enough’. Even if the expectations placed on you by your PD are low, there is no reason to plummet to that level. That presenter let himself down. He didn’t let the station down (they’re doing a pretty good job of that themselves, without his help). For the four hours on the air, he was the radio station. He could have made it sound like the market leader, just by raising his game. He could have related to me and been my friend and sounded the same as me. Instead he was just another ‘DJ’, going through the motions waiting to go home. In fact he said so: “I’ll be here until six o’clock”. He actually told us when he was quitting work. It was obviously on his mind. No matter the feed back or level of expectation – you be the best you can be. You give it all you can give it. Hey, if the station is performing poorly and you are performing brilliantly, just think how you will stand out! Your work rate will sound amazing compared to any lethargic co-workers that happen to be on the schedule. You will be the main person on the station. That presenter I listened to didn’t sound bothered and neither was I. I won’t be listening to him again.

Help Me Fight Cancer
(Tuesday April 24, 2007) Written by Adam Chandler
I would like to tell you about my wife Molly... On December 12, 2005 we came home from my company's Christmas party and while Molly was getting ready for bed, she thought she felt a lump in her right breast. After 20 minutes of re-examining the area, and asking my opinion[hell I'm a guy, rub some dirt on it and get on with the day] but trying to be a reassuring husband, I told her that she knew her body better than anyone, and if she felt uncomfortable, she should go to the doctor. A few days passed and she went in for an exam. It was a Saturday morning and I was working on the "Honey-Do" list for the townhouse that she had left for me. Hours went by and I was almost done with the list, the last thing to do was frame out the mirrors in the two bathrooms, stain the frames, and then mount them. 8 hours past. When she came home, she informed me that there was a lump and that women get them all of the time. She said the reason why her exam took so long was that her doctor wanted to make sure that she didn't miss anything. Three days past and Molly received a job offer from Country Insurance in their billing department. This news helped take our minds off of the pending test results and we went out to dinner to celebrate her new job. At dinner we laughed, talked about the future - when will we buy a house and start having kids, to taking long vacations instead of simply focusing on work. When we returned from dinner, Molly went to our neighbor's townhouse to tell them the good news about her new job... I went in and played the answering machine. The doctor had called and said that Molly could stop in the next day to go over her test results or, if she wanted to, Molly could call her at home because "she'd be up all night" and it would be fine for Molly to call. Not good. When Molly called her doctor, I could hear it in her voice - the news was not good. She had just lost her mother to cancer one-year ago and now she's being told that she has breast cancer at the age of 28. I was helpless. There was no way for me to protect my wife from the cancer and the only thing I could do was hold her as tight as I possibly could and be strong for her. On December 30, she went in and had a successful lumpectomy. In February of 2006, she started her chemotherapy treatments, 4-hour sessions every 3 weeks for eight weeks. Once that was done, she had 6-weeks of daily radiation treatment on her breast and under her right arm, where doctors removed several lymph nodes to see if the cancer had spread from the lump. Which it did. However, we caught the lump at an early stage, allowing the doctors to catch the cancer in the lymph nodes at an early stage. As our doctor put it: "The lymph node is like an M&M. As long as we catch the cancer within the chocolate center, before it breaks through the candy shell, we should be fine". It's been almost 15 months and Molly is cancer free. Her hair is growing back - curly and thick, while mine is thinning and falling out. It's long enough for her to style and she goes in for her check up in April to make sure she's still cancer free. The doctors say she'll need to do these check ups once every 6 months over the next year, then she'll just have to do them every 12 months. I would not wish what we went through on my worst enemy in high school and I would love to see the day we find a cure for this disease. Even though the doctors have said that there's only a 2% chance that the cancer may return, I'd feel a lot better if we were given a guarantee that the cancer would never return. So, until the day comes when we have a cure, I will be a part of Relay for Life - helping raise money to find a cure.
